Zapopan is a separate municipality, and nearly every practical rule follows the municipality

Critical

The metro area is one city in conversation and nine municipal governments in fact, and Zapopan is the largest of them — roughly 1.6 million people by CONAPO's mid-2025 projection, more than Guadalajara proper, spread over an area several times larger. Your predial rate and its discount calendar, rubbish collection, municipal police, parking and photo-infraction enforcement, building and business licences and even which Cruz Verde ambulance comes are Zapopan's, not Guadalajara's. When a neighbour, landlord or blog tells you how something works in 'Guadalajara', the first question is always which municipio they mean — and if your address is in Zapopan, half the answer changes.

The corporate and semiconductor jobs people move here for are physically in Zapopan

Important

The 'Mexican Silicon Valley' story gets told about Guadalajara, but the offices are largely across the municipal line. Intel's Guadalajara Design Center sits in Colonia El Bajío in Zapopan; the corporate towers, the multinational back offices and the consultancies cluster along the Andares, Puerta de Hierro, Real Acueducto and Av. Patria corridor, also Zapopan; Tec de Monterrey's Guadalajara campus and the Universidad Autónoma de Guadalajara are in Zapopan too. If your offer is from one of those and you rent in Colonia Americana because that is the neighbourhood you read about, you have bought yourself a daily crossing of the whole metro area at rush hour.

Pay predial in January — Zapopan's discount is real money and its calendar is its own

Important

Zapopan collects more property tax than any other municipality in the country and has done for several years running, and it uses discounts aggressively to get it in early. For 2026 the headline was 15% off in January, with an additional card-payment discount in January and February, plus standing reductions of 50% at 60, 60% at 70 and up to 80% at 80, and 50% for people with a disability, pensioners and widows. There are seventeen ways to pay, including the Predial Zapopan app and a WhatsApp bot. Guadalajara and Tlaquepaque run their own, different schedules — check the one for your municipality and diarise it, because the difference between paying in January and paying in April is a meaningful sum on a family home.

Ask which tandeo block the address is on — and in a new tower, ask about the cistern anyway

Important

SIAPA supplies much of the metro area on a rotating roster rather than continuously, and the schedule is granular enough that two streets in the same colonia can differ. Zapopan's newest towers have proper cisterns, pumps and rooftop tanks, which makes tandeo invisible until the pump fails; the older colonias around the centre and the fast-growing northern fringe towards Tesistán and Nuevo México have thinner infrastructure and feel it. Ask the landlord for the tandeo day, ask when the aljibe was last cleaned, and if you can, visit on the off day rather than a convenient afternoon.

Spring is fire season in the Bosque de La Primavera, and the smoke settles over Zapopan first

Important

The 30,000-hectare protected forest on Zapopan's western flank is the metro area's lung and its most reliable air-quality problem. Between roughly February and June, fires there are frequent, and SEMADET has repeatedly activated atmospheric alerts naming Zapopan alongside Tala and El Arenal when the smoke lands. Combined with the winter thermal inversion that traps traffic particulates in the basin, that gives Zapopan two distinct bad-air windows a year. If anyone in the household has asthma, this belongs in the neighbourhood decision, not in the small print.

12 October shuts down the axis into Zapopan, and it is worth planning around rather than resenting

Good to know

La Romería — the procession that walks the Virgin of Zapopan from the cathedral in Guadalajara back to her basilica — draws around two million people and closes the main roads into Zapopan centre for most of the day. UNESCO inscribed the ritual cycle it belongs to on the Representative List of the Intangible Cultural Heritage of Humanity in 2018, and the cycle itself runs from May to October, so smaller processions occur through the summer. Do not schedule a move, a delivery or an airport run for 12 October. Do go and watch the Wixárika dance groups at least once.
